前言
随着微信公众号等社交媒体的普及,开发者需要进行与之交互的前端开发,其中包含了消息的接收和处理。npm 包 wechat-message-handlers 便是为了方便开发者处理微信公众号及企业号的消息而诞生的。本篇文章介绍了使用 wechat-message-handlers 的详细步骤及示例代码,希望对开发者有所帮助。
wechat-message-handlers 简介
wechat-message-handlers 是一个方便 Front-end 开发者处理微信公众号及企业号消息的 npm 包。其主要功能包括:构造回复消息,解析消息内容等等。
安装 wechat-message-handlers
你可以通过 npm 命令来安装 wechat-message-handlers:
--- ------- -----------------------
使用 wechat-message-handlers
使用 wechat-message-handlers 需要进行如下步骤:
导入 wechat-message-handlers
首先需要将 wechat-message-handlers 导入当前的项目中。
代码示例:
----- - ------ - - -----------------------------------
获取消息内容
接收消息后,需要获取其中的内容。
代码示例:
----- ------------------- - ----- ----- ---- -- - ----- ---- - ----- --- ----------------- ------- -- - --- ---- - --- -------------- ----- -- - ---- -- ------ --- ------------- -- -- - -------------- --- --- ----- ------- - ----- ------------- -- ---- --
构造回复消息
在处理完消息后,需要将回复消息构造好。
代码示例:
----- ---------------- - --------- -------- -- - ----- ----- - - ----------- --------------------- ------------- ------------------- ----------- --- ----------------- -------- ------- -------- -------- -- ------ ------ --
返回消息
将构造好的回复消息返回给用户。
代码示例:
----------------------------- ------------------- --------- ----- ------------------------------------------------------------ -------------------------------------------------------------- ----------------- ------------------------------ ----------------------------------------------- ----------------------------------------------- ------ ---
总结
通过以上步骤,我们可以使用 wechat-message-handlers 顺利地处理微信公众号及企业号消息,包括构造回复消息、解析消息内容等等。当然,还可以根据业务需要增加其他功能。
示例代码:
----- - ------ - - ----------------------------------- ----- ------------------- - ----- ----- ---- -- - ----- ---- - ----- --- ----------------- ------- -- - --- ---- - --- -------------- ----- -- - ---- -- ------ --- ------------- -- -- - -------------- --- --- ----- ------- - ----- ------------- -- ---- ----- ------- - ----------------- ----- ----- - ------------------------- --------- ----------------------------- ------------------- --------- ----- ------------------------------------------------------------ -------------------------------------------------------------- ----------------- ------------------------------ ----------------------------------------------- ----------------------------------------------- ------ --- -- ----- ---------------- - --------- -------- -- - ----- ----- - - ----------- --------------------- ------------- ------------------- ----------- --- ----------------- -------- ------- -------- -------- -- ------ ------ --
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/600671098dd3466f61ffdfdd